From: Andrew Pinski Date: Sun, 7 Sep 2025 16:33:07 +0000 (-0700) Subject: forwprop: Improve rejection of overlapping for copyprop of aggregates [PR121841] X-Git-Url: http://git.ipfire.org/?a=commitdiff_plain;h=7e1143abd32cd40d24479d4c536b610ea9aad2db;p=thirdparty%2Fgcc.git forwprop: Improve rejection of overlapping for copyprop of aggregates [PR121841] Here we have: tmp = src1[0]; dest1[0] = tmp; where src1 and dest1 are decls. We currently reject this as the bases are different but since the bases are decls we know they won't overlap. This adds the extra check to allow this. Bootstrapped and tested on x86_64-linux-gnu. PR tree-optimization/121841 gcc/ChangeLog: * tree-ssa-forwprop.cc (optimize_agr_copyprop_1): Allow two different decls as bases as non-overlapping bases. gcc/testsuite/ChangeLog: * gcc.dg/tree-ssa/copy-prop-aggregate-struct-1.c: New test.
